Associative property of addition: Changing grouping of addends doesn't change the sum.

Distributive property: Multiplying a sum by a number is the same as multiplying each addend by that number and then adding the two products.

Associative property of multiplication: Changing grouping of the factors doesn't change the products.

Commutative property of multiplication: Changing order of the factors doesn't change the products.

Commutative property of addition:  Changing order of addends doesn't change the sum.
